Output 34176019dd50f02f5510c5485ec4c26bef5fb7c28b7fcd0ed59439dcb9ff0d6d:5

value
395506
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a1f1c7f3d8996f335d32639312a98a4472f58d0f27f15a6764f94017f27ef5a6
address
tb1p58cu0u7cn9hnxhfjvwf392v2g3e0trg0ylc45emyl9qp0un77knq0fwxsp
transaction
34176019dd50f02f5510c5485ec4c26bef5fb7c28b7fcd0ed59439dcb9ff0d6d
spent
true